WebApr 25, 2016 · It’s also possible for the immune system to defeat hepatitis B virus and HPV — but in some cases, these viruses are able to settle in for the long haul, causing chronic infections that can endure for life and even lead to cancer. Left untreated, syphilis can kill, and gonorrhea can cause infertility. Non-viral STDs, like chlamydia and ... WebAnswer (1 of 18): Have you ever had a cold? Did it eventually end? That's an example of a viral infection going away by itself. That's not entirely accurate, of course. Your body's immune system did battle with the virus that caused your cold symptoms and eventually suppressed or eliminated it...

For most people who have a healthy immune system, HPV will clear itself within one to two years. The rest will develop a persistent infection that will create abnormalities in the cervical cells. Eventually, if left untreated, precancerous abnormalities, known as dysplasia, can develop. This can take a long time, though. In the meantime, the virus that causes warts can spread to other parts of the body, which may lead to more warts. Treatment can help a wart clear more quickly.
